Greek Letter Omega

Greek Letter Omega – Blocking High Pressure Shaped Like It. | Image by wiki.com

An upper level ridge of high pressure, called an “Omega Block” because it is shaped like the Greek letter Omega, (Shaded “Arch” shape with blue arrows) has taken over clearing us out and keeping the sunshine around for the rest of the workweek. A cold front sneaks by the ridge and crosses the Oregon coast Saturday with another front right behind it and you know what that means, some clouds and maybe some rain. Maybe another chance of minimally active weather Sunday from a weak frontal system.
